Mortgage loan volumes in Romania gain 49% on eight months

by Property Forum
Mortgage loans worth €5.5 billion were granted in total at a national level in the first eight months of 2024, up 49% compared with the same period of last year, according to data from the National Bank of Romania (NBR).

UDI prepares plot for new resi project in Belgrade

by Property Forum
UDI Group is launching its next residential project Zvezdano Brdo (Starry Hill) in the capital of Serbia, Belgrade. Serbia is the largest foreign market for the Czech UDI Group. It is building or preparing four projects here, including the entire new Duga district for CZK 14 billion (€555 million).

New leases

  • Panattoni has signed an agreement with a new tenant for its urban development in Łódź. Olmed, which operates a pharmacy and online drugstore, has taken up 9,500 sqm of space in City Logistics Łódź VI.
  • The Polish subsidiary of Hoerbiger, specialized in precision positioning technologies, has leased 200 sqm in the Warsaw-based SOHO by Yareal. The company will start operations in the new offices this May.
  • Ingram Micro, the global distributor of IT solutions and mobile devices, has renewed its lease at the MLP Pruszków II logistics center, covering around 8,200 sqm of modern warehouse and office space. The lease deal was brokered by CBRE.

New appointments

  • Avison Young has strengthened its Polish operations by recruiting Natalia Puza and Damian Bafeltowski. Puza joins as Senior Consultant in the Office Agency, bringing over 11 years of experience. In her new role, she will support office projects in Warsaw and regional markets. Bafeltowski joins the Investment Advisory division as a Consultant. He will focus on market analysis and commercial due diligence across all real estate sectors.
  • Joanna Leńkowska has been appointed as Workthere Lead at Savills Poland, taking over the role from Thomas Jodar. Leńkowska brings five years of experience in the flexible office sector to the team, having previously worked with WeWork and CitySpace.
  • CTP Romania has appointed Diane-Monique Forrest as Business Developer. She will focus on leasing activities in Transylvania, covering key cities such as Timișoara, Arad, Sibiu, and Deva.
